Britannia Institutional Investor Meet Cancelled: Company Withdraws March 13 Meeting

Britannia Industries Limited has announced the cancellation of its institutional investor meeting that was scheduled for March 13. The update regarding the Britannia institutional investor meet was shared through a regulatory filing, informing stakeholders that the planned interaction with investors will no longer take place on the previously announced date.

Details of the Cancelled Meeting

The Britannia institutional investor meet was originally planned as an interaction between the company’s management and institutional investors. Such meetings typically provide an opportunity for investors to gain deeper insights into a company’s operations, strategy, and growth plans.

However, according to the latest announcement, the Britannia institutional investor meet scheduled for March 13 has been cancelled. The company has not indicated a new date for the meeting at this stage.

About Britannia Industries

Britannia Industries Limited is one of India’s leading food companies and a major player in the fast-moving consumer goods (FMCG) sector. The company is widely known for its popular biscuit brands and packaged food products.

Britannia operates a wide distribution network across India and international markets. Over the years, the company has expanded its product portfolio to include dairy products, cakes, bread, and other packaged food items.
